-# Pi.Alert Installation Guide
-
-Initially designed to run on a Raspberry PI, probably it can run on many other
-Linux distributions.
-
-Estimated time: 20'
-
-### Dependencies
- | Dependency | Comments |
- | ---------- | -------------------------------------------------------- |
- | Lighttpd | Probably works on other webservers / not tested |
- | arp-scan | Required for Scan Method 1 |
- | Pi.hole | Optional. Scan Method 2. Check devices doing DNS queries |
- | dnsmasq | Optional. Scan Method 3. Check devices using DHCP server |
- | IEEE HW DB | Necessary to identified Device vendor |
-

-## Installation process (step by step)
-
-
-### Raspberry Setup
-
-1.1 - Install 'Raspberry Pi OS'
- - Instructions https://www.raspberrypi.org/documentation/installation/installing-images/
- - *Lite version (without Desktop) is enough for Pi.Alert*
-
-1.2 - Activate ssh
- - Create a empty file with name 'ssh' in the boot partition of the SD
-
-1.3 - Start the raspberry
-
-1.4 - Login to the system with pi user
- ```
- user: pi
- password: raspberry
- ```
-
-1.5 - Change the default password of pi user
- ```
- passwd
- ```
-
-1.6 - Setup the basic configuration
- ```
- sudo raspi-config
- ```
-
-1.7 - Optionally, configure a static IP in raspi-config
-
-1.8 - Update the OS
- ```
- sudo apt-get update
- sudo apt-get upgrade
- sudo shutdown -r now
- ```

-### Lighttpd & PHP
-
-If you have installed Pi.hole, lighttpd and PHP are already installed and this
-block is not necessary
-
-3.1 - Install apt-utils
- ```
- sudo apt-get install apt-utils -y
- ```
-
-3.2 - Install lighttpd
- ```
- sudo apt-get install lighttpd -y
- ```
-
-3.3 - If Pi.Alert will be the only site available in this webserver, you can
- redirect the default server page to pialert subfolder
- ```
- sudo mv /var/www/html/index.lighttpd.html /var/www/html/index.lighttpd.html.old
- sudo ln -s ~/pialert/install/index.html /var/www/html/index.html
- ```
-
-3.4 - Install PHP
- ```
- sudo apt-get install php php-cgi php-fpm php-sqlite3 -y
- ```
-
-3.5 - Activate PHP
- ```
- sudo lighttpd-enable-mod fastcgi-php
- sudo service lighttpd restart
- ```
-
-3.6 - Install sqlite3
- ```
- sudo apt-get install sqlite3 -y
- ```
-
-
-### arp-scan & Python
-
-4.1 - Install arp-scan utility and test
- ```
- sudo apt-get install arp-scan -y
- sudo arp-scan -l
- ```
-
-4.2 - Install dnsutils & net-tools utilities
- ```
- sudo apt-get install dnsutils net-tools -y
- ```
-
-4.3 - Test Python
-
- New versions of 'Raspberry Pi OS' includes Python. You can check that
- Python is installed with the command:
- ```
- python -V
- ```
-
- New versions of Ubuntu includes Python 3. You can choose between use `python3`
- command or to install Python 2 (that includes `python` command).
-
-
- If you prefer to use Python 3, in the next installation block, you must update
- `pialert.cron` file with the correct command: `python3` instead of `python`.
- ```
- python3 -V
- ```
-
-4.4 - If Python is not installed in your system, you can install it with this
- command:
- ```
- sudo apt-get install python
- ```
- Or this one if you prefer Python 3:
- ```
- sudo apt-get install python3
- ```

-### Pi.Alert
-
-5.1 - Download Pi.Alert and uncompress
- ```
- cd
- curl -LO https://github.com/pucherot/Pi.Alert/raw/main/tar/pialert_latest.tar
- tar xvf pialert_latest.tar
- rm pialert_latest.tar
- ```
-
-5.2 - Public the front portal
- ```
- sudo ln -s ~/pialert/front /var/www/html/pialert
- ```
-
-5.3 - Configure web server redirection
-
- If you have configured your DNS server (Pi.hole or other) to resolve pi.alert
- with the IP of your raspberry, youy must configure lighttpd to redirect these
- requests to the correct pialert web folder
- ```
- sudo cp ~/pialert/install/pialert_front.conf /etc/lighttpd/conf-available
- sudo ln -s ../conf-available/pialert_front.conf /etc/lighttpd/conf-enabled/pialert_front.conf
- sudo /etc/init.d/lighttpd restart
- ```
-
-5.4 - If you want to use email reporting with gmail
- - Go to your Google Account https://myaccount.google.com/
- - On the left navigation panel, click Security
- - On the bottom of the page, in the Less secure app access panel,
- click Turn on access
- - Click Save button
-
-5.5 - Config Pialert parameters
- ```
- sed -i "s,'/home/pi/pialert','$HOME/pialert'," ~/pialert/config/pialert.conf
- nano ~/pialert/config/pialert.conf
- ```
- - If you want to use email reporting, configure this parameters
- ```ini
- REPORT_MAIL = True
- REPORT_TO = 'user@gmail.com'
- SMTP_SERVER = 'smtp.gmail.com'
- SMTP_PORT = 587
- SMTP_USER = 'user@gmail.com'
- SMTP_PASS = 'password'
- ```
-
- - If you want to update your Dynamic DNS, configure this parameters
- ```ini
- DDNS_ACTIVE = True
- DDNS_DOMAIN = 'your_domain.freeddns.org'
- DDNS_USER = 'dynu_user'
- DDNS_PASSWORD = 'A0000000B0000000C0000000D0000000'
- DDNS_UPDATE_URL = 'https://api.dynu.com/nic/update?'
- ```
-
- - If you have installed Pi.hole and DHCP, activate this parameters
- ```ini
- PIHOLE_ACTIVE = True
- DHCP_ACTIVE = True
- ```
-
-5.6 - Update vendors DB
- ```
- python ~/pialert/back/pialert.py update_vendors
- ```
- or
- ```
- python3 ~/pialert/back/pialert.py update_vendors
- ```
-
-5.7 - Test Pi.Alert Scan
- ```
- python ~/pialert/back/pialert.py internet_IP
- python ~/pialert/back/pialert.py 1
- ```
- or
- ```
- python3 ~/pialert/back/pialert.py internet_IP
- python3 ~/pialert/back/pialert.py 1
- ```
-
-5.8 - Update crontab template with python3
-
- If you prefer to use Python 3 (installed in the previous block), you must
- update `pialert.cron` file with the correct command: `python3` instead of
- `python`
- ```
- sed -i 's/python/python3/g' ~/pialert/install/pialert.cron
- ```
-
-5.9 - Add crontab jobs
- ```
- (crontab -l 2>/dev/null; cat ~/pialert/install/pialert.cron) | crontab -
- ```
-
-5.10 - Add permissions to the web-server user
- ```
- sudo chgrp -R www-data ~/pialert/db
- chmod -R 770 ~/pialert/db
- ```

-# Pi.Alert Uninstallation Guide
-
-Estimated time: 5'
-
-
-## One-step Automated Uninstall:
-
- #### `curl -sSL https://github.com/pucherot/Pi.Alert/raw/main/install/pialert_uninstall.sh | bash`
-
-## Uninstallation process (step by step)
-
-
-1.1 - Remove Pi.Alert files
- ```
- rm -r "~/pialert"
- ```
-
-1.2 - Remove Pi.Alert web front
- ```
- sudo rm "/var/www/html/pialert"
- ```
-
-1.3 - Remove lighttpd Pi.Alert config
- ```
- sudo rm "/etc/lighttpd/conf-available/pialert_front.conf"
- sudo rm "/etc/lighttpd/conf-enabled/pialert_front.conf"
- ```
-
-1.4 - Remove lighttpd Pi.Alert cache
- ```
- sudo rm -r /var/cache/lighttpd/compress/pialert
- ```
-
-1.5 - Remove Pi.Alert DNS entry
- ```
- sudo sed -i '/pi.alert/d' /etc/pihole/custom.list
- sudo pihole restartdns
- ```
-
-1.6 - Remove Pi.Alert crontab jobs
- ```
- crontab -l 2>/dev/null | sed ':a;N;$!ba;s/#-------------------------------------------------------------------------------\n# Pi.Alert\n# Open Source Network Guard \/ WIFI & LAN intrusion detector \n#\n# pialert.cron - Back module. Crontab jobs\n#-------------------------------------------------------------------------------\n# Puche 2021 pi.alert.application@gmail.com GNU GPLv3\n#-------------------------------------------------------------------------------//g' | crontab -
- crontab -l 2>/dev/null | sed '/pialert.py/d' | crontab -
- ```
-
-### Uninstallation Notes
-
- - If you installed Pi-hole during the Pi.Alert installation process,
-
- Pi-hole will still be available after uninstalling Pi.Alert
-
-
- - lighttpd, PHP, arp-scan & Python have not been uninstalled
-
- They may be required by other software
-
- You can uninstall them manually with command 'apt-get remove XX'
